NASA’s Nancy Grace Roman Space Telescope is photographed after encapsulation inside its payload fairing in the Payload Hazardous Servicing Facility at NASA’s Kennedy Space Center in Florida on Monday, Aug. 24, 2026, ahead of mating to a SpaceX Falcon Heavy rocket. Encapsulation shields the spacecraft during rollout, ascent, and the early phases of flight. Roman will investigate dark energy and dark matter, conduct a statistical census of planetary systems, and enable a broad range of additional astrophysics research. Liftoff from Launch Complex 39A at Kennedy is targeted for no earlier than Sunday, Aug. 30, 2026.
